Hey Guys..
NAV 2011 / NIS 2011 is already available for download. For those whose subscription is still valid then you can just click open your NAV/NIS main menu and then click 'Account'. Then login to your account on the web. After that click update and then follow instruction. Done.
Good luck on your latest Norton.

i switch from kaspersky to norton recently. i find norton easier and lighter on resources. protection i think both are quite on par. configuring of firewall is much easier to work out/understand which i find difficult to use under kaspersky. kaspersky pop up is super annoying as it keeps forgetting the rules i set.
